Output 586924646a10488121ea181f8a33c67f2a7ade94261c8ebf1db2c11a11eaab18:0

value
1799248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95cd59093a30d50c436cc0fcbdd01f5be65a40bb OP_EQUALVERIFY OP_CHECKSIG
address
1Ef5gQ5D8wNsp5rWSNRQmsY4cPsQ8Yrudk
transaction
586924646a10488121ea181f8a33c67f2a7ade94261c8ebf1db2c11a11eaab18